NAPEBT Wellness Incentive Deadline: May 15
Incentive Clarification

  • Is the deadline of the points for wellness changing? No. Administratively we are unable to do this.
  • I can't get my annual exam or biometrics. Does this mean I can't participate? No. You can earn points in many ways including but not limited to our NEW Wellness Journeys which are online behavior change programs worth 6 points each.
  • Are the annual exam and biometrics required to earn an incentive? No. You can earn points in any way you see fit. Physical activity with home exercise videos or online programs and webinars. You choose!

Staying Positive
It's normal to feel anxiety and stress. Everyone finds different tools more helpful than others. Identifying multiple strategies and tools will give you and your loved ones what you need as you navigate changes now and in the future.
